A malfunctioning fuel pump delivers too much or too little fuel from the gas tank.


A fuel pressure drop can be caused by a clogged fuel filter, which can result in the pump drawing vacuum, which leads to fuel aeration (air bubbles in the fuel ). A dirty filter will force the pump to over-work as it tries to push fuel , leading to premature pump failure. Usually, a bad or failing fuel pump will produce one or more of the following symptoms that alert the driver of a potential issue. Whining Noise From the Fuel Tank. One of the first symptoms of a problem with the fuel pump is a loud whining sound. An old or worn fuel pump may produce a noticeably loud whine or howl while running.

Both dust and sudden voltage increases can influence a fuel pump relay’s performance and cause the vital function of an engine to malfunction. If the fuel pump is not delivering adequate fuel pressure and volume to the engine, the engine may not start or run properly.


Low fuel pressure can cause hard starting, a rough idle, misfiring, hesitation and stalling. Running the vehicle out of fuel , which will actually run the pump in a dry state can shorten the expected life span. Fuel pump problems are not easy to diagnose , specially because some symptoms are similar to those produced by problems in other systems. Also, troubles with a sensor can hinder the fuel system, making it hard to diagnose without some repair experience and special diagnostic tools.


Fuel delivery problems can often be traced back to problems with the electrical system that prevent the fuel pump from receiving the correct power, which will cause the pump to perform poorly or not at all. To diagnose , conduct both a fuel pressure and fuel volume test to see if the pump can output the proper amount of fuel.


Lack of power can be a failing fuel pump symptom A fuel pump must output at least the minimum pressure and volume specified by the car maker. Locate your fuel pump test point, which is usually near the fuel injectors, and locate the point at which the pump hooks up with the filter injector rail. There should be a separation joint or a test port, where the pressure gauge attaches.
